Is Poznan Safe for Solo Female Travelers?

Poznan is generally a safe city for solo female travelers. Most parts of the city are tourist-friendly and incidents of crime against tourists are low. However, like in any city, you should always stay alert, especially in crowded places and late at night. Public transportation is reliable and often used by tourists. Polish people usually understand English and are known for their hospitality. Remember to respect the local customs and rules.

How safe is Poznan?

Safety at night:

Safety at night:Safe

Poznan is generally quite safe at night, with a low crime rate compared to many other European cities. The city center is well lit and typically bustling with locals and tourists. However, as with any location, it's always important to stay alert and aware of your surroundings, especially in less crowded or poorly lit areas.
Public transportation:

Public transportation:Safe

Public transportation in Poznan is generally safe and reliable. Buses and trams run regularly, even during the night, and are quite dependable. They are well-kept and usually not crowded, with the occasional exception during rush hours. The stations and stops are also well-lit and frequently used, which increases the feeling of safety. However, as with any location, it's always important to stay alert and cautious, especially when traveling alone and at night.
Street harassment:

Street harassment:Low

Poznan, a city in west-central Poland, is known to be safe and welcoming for solo female travelers. Instances of street harassment are relatively low and not a common occurrence. While exploring the city, you should feel comfortable and safe, although vigilance is always recommended. The locals are polite and respectful, but like any place in the world, occasional inconveniences may occur at times.
Petty crimes:

Petty crimes:Low

Poznan is generally a safe city with a low incidence of petty crimes such as pickpocketing or bag snatching. However, it is always wise to maintain vigilance, especially in crowded places, at night, or in areas with a higher concentration of bars and clubs.

Poznan is overall a safe city, the streets are clean and the city center is almost never devoid of people (usually students partying). There sometimes appear situation of catcalling, but I'd say it's getting more rare each year (in any case, I usually ignore it and people don't get agressive). You also shouldn't worry too much if you are visiting as a same-sex couple, since Poznań is thought to be the most LGBTQ+ friendly city of Poland.
